Are strollers allowed?
Yes, however, we require that you start near the back of your specific event corral to avoid tripping or congestion with all the runners. This is very important for us to create the safest environment possible for ALL participants. Babies in strollers do not need to be registered. You will still be eligible for age group awards with your chip time that is tracked from the time you cross the start line to the time you finish.
Are dogs allowed?
We love dogs, however, our insurance policy does not allow dogs. If you have a 4-legged running companion for medical reasons, you can file a request through the USATF ADA Committee (which takes 4-6 weeks) by CLICKING HERE and if they approve, they will provide you with documentation that you will then need to provide to us.
Race Bibs
Race bibs must be worn on the front of your body and always be visible for EVERYONE on course. If anyone is on the course without a bib you will be asked to leave the course. If you are running with a companion that does not have a bib you will both be asked to leave the course. No companion bicycles, scooters, golf carts or unregistered runners/walkers allowed. Why? This is strictly prohibited by USATF sanctions and our insurance. It puts our event at a large risk! Spectators are welcome at any point on course.
Weather Contingency Plan
In the event of inclement weather prior to 8:00AM, the start time of the first event may be delayed by up to 30 minutes. If a delay of more than 30 minutes is necessary and the weather conditions continue to be unsafe for the run, the event will be cancelled for all participants. Participants will be notified of event changes via the race website, email and social media.
Are your courses certified?
No, however courses were measured using the same techniques as USATF certification, a proven method that incorporates the calibration of measuring devices against a steel tape.
What pace am I required to keep?
Participants in the 8K are required to maintain at least a 13:45 per mile pace (1 hour 8 minutes). Anyone slower than that pace will be asked to move to the sidewalk by CMPD. Participants in the 5K walking slower than a 20:00 per mile pace may be asked to move to the sidewalk by CMPD.

Age Restrictions
We have no age restrictions for the 8K and 5K, however, we do require parental consent. Anyone under 18 must have a parent or guardian sign the waiver. For the Tot Trot, we ask that participants be 8 years old or younger at time of event.
Age Discounts
We do offer a $5 discount on our regular 8K, 5K and 1 Mile registration fees for participants under the age of 18 at the time of registration. Discounts will be automatically applied during the checkout process.
Changing a Shirt Size
A link to shirt sizing is HERE. You may adjust your shirt size by logging into your RunSignUp account no less than four (4) days prior to the race. If you miss the cutoff for this, you will receive the shirt size at packet pick-up that you initially registered. We cannot switch sizes onsite at packet pick-ups. However, we will offer a “Shirt Exchange” table on race day after 9:30AM if we have an abundance of sizes. If we don’t have your size, you may choose not to wear the shirt and trade it in after the race for another size based on availability.

Event Parking
Event day parking is available (and free) at all deck and surface lots at SouthPark Mall, plus numerous surrounding lots. There are 7,000+ parking spots at the mall, so plenty of space! The only lots off limits are those closest to DICK'S Sporting Goods. We recommend you enter the mall to park via Fairview Rd. or Sharon Rd. Please see our parking map for more information.
Awards
Overall Female, Male and Non-Binary awards will be given out for 1st through 3rd place in the 8K and 5K events. In the 8K we will also give out Masters top 3 overall. Winners will receive one of our iconic ceramic Turkey Trophies and they will be announced onsite on race morning.
In addition, we're excited to offer Female, Male and Non-Binary 1st – 3rd place awards in the following age categories for both the 8K and 5K events: 7 & under, 8-11, 12-14, 15-19, 20-24, 25-29, 30-34, 35-39, 40-44, 45-49, 50-54, 55-59, 60-64, 65-69, 70-74, 75 & up. Award winners will receive a commemorative Charlotte Turkey Trot 2026 Richardson 112 Trucker Hat. Age group awards can be picked up at the Start 2 Finish Solutions Tent at the Finish Festival beginning at 9:20AM for the 8K and 10:20AM for the 5K.
Individual age group winners will NOT be announced. Note that age group awards are based on “chip time”, so awards are not final until the pick-up times listed above. To see if you have won an award, scan the QR code on the back of your bib post-race. Award winners are denoted with a trophy icon and "Award Winner" shown below your race statistics.
